Transaction 981960bfca4806c958116205a046805d79d7e7196df21be2e2b60ccb3a96d877

1 Input
2 Outputs
  • 981960bfca4806c958116205a046805d79d7e7196df21be2e2b60ccb3a96d877:0
  • value  27096001
    address  3GzHYqGTVqDpwGzCSS7DMv9hzpyNoPSLRQ
  • 981960bfca4806c958116205a046805d79d7e7196df21be2e2b60ccb3a96d877:1
  • value  50000000
    address  3G1nNTTyrpZBwyEiG6U3bJvZdu9sW3rbUz